About Salon Boutique Academy

Salon Boutique Academy is a private for-profit trade school in Addison, Texas, enrolling about 200 students. Programs focus on certificates and workforce credentials that prepare students for skilled trades and technical careers. The published completion rate is about 76.92% at 150% of normal time. Student demographics in federal data include Hispanic or Latino (46.5%) and Black or African American (34.5%) among the largest enrollment groups.

Finding Average net price at Salon Boutique Academy is $19,055.

Evidence College Scorecard average net price is $19,055 (cost of attendance minus average grant aid for aided undergraduates). That is about $11,024 above the Texas median net price. Versus rural campuses, net price runs $355 above the locale median.

Method Average net price from College Scorecard; compared with state, locale, and U.S. medians from EDsmart aggregates.

Interpretation Average net price is a stronger institutional cost signal than published tuition because it incorporates grant aid.

Limitation The campus average masks large differences by household income; income-band net prices can diverge sharply from the overall average.

Student Loan Default Rate

0.00% 3-year cohort default rate (College Scorecard)

The published 3-year cohort default rate for borrowers at Salon Boutique Academy was 0.00%.

Cohort default rates account for borrowers who default in the first three years.
